Nawabpur Ganga Population - Shahjahanpur, Uttar Pradesh

Nawabpur Ganga is a medium size village located in Powayan Tehsil of Shahjahanpur district, Uttar Pradesh with total 261 families residing. The Nawabpur Ganga village has population of 1425 of which 766 are males while 659 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Nawabpur Ganga village population of children with age 0-6 is 251 which makes up 17.61 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Nawabpur Ganga village is 860 which is lower than Uttar Pradesh state average of 912. Child Sex Ratio for the Nawabpur Ganga as per census is 887, lower than Uttar Pradesh average of 902.

Nawabpur Ganga village has lower literacy rate compared to Uttar Pradesh. In 2011, literacy rate of Nawabpur Ganga village was 62.86 % compared to 67.68 % of Uttar Pradesh. In Nawabpur Ganga Male literacy stands at 75.36 % while female literacy rate was 48.24 %.

Caste Factor

Schedule Caste (SC) constitutes 10.60 % of total population in Nawabpur Ganga village. The village Nawabpur Ganga currently doesn’t have any Schedule Tribe (ST) population.

Work Profile

In Nawabpur Ganga village out of total population, 375 were engaged in work activities. 95.73 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 4.27 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 375 workers engaged in Main Work, 78 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 208 were Agricultural labourer.
